The Shift from “Prompting” to “Directing”
The early days of AI for video relied on “slot machine” mechanics—you typed a prompt and hoped for the best. Today’s high-end tools provide a suite of granular controls that mimic a physical film set.
1. Advanced Camera Orchestration
Professional AI for video platforms now allow for explicit camera blocking. Instead of hoping the AI zooms in, directors can specify:
- Dolly Shots: Moving the “virtual camera” toward or away from a subject.
- Pan and Tilt: Sweeping the view horizontally or vertically to reveal information.
- Focus Pulls: Shifting the depth of field from the foreground to the background to guide the viewer’s eye.
2. Motion Brushes and Regional Control
High-end workflows require that only specific elements move. If a director wants the clouds to drift but the trees to remain still, they use Motion Brushes. By painting over specific pixels, the creator tells the AI for video engine exactly where to apply kinetic energy. This prevents the “hallucination” effect where the entire scene morphs or warps unnecessarily.
High-End Technical Consistency
The hallmark of a professional production is consistency. In the past, AI struggled with “flicker” or changing character details between shots. The current generation of AI for video solves this through:
- Character Consistency Models: You can upload a reference image of an actor, and the AI will maintain their facial structure, clothing, and proportions across different environments and lighting conditions.
- Temporal Stability: Advanced neural architectures now ensure that the physics of a scene—like the way a silk dress ripples in the wind—remain fluid and logical across 10-second or 60-second clips.
- Resolution Upscaling: High-end users generate at lower resolutions to save time, then use AI-driven spatial upscalers to output 4K or 8K files that are “broadcast ready” for television or cinema screens.

Integrating AI into the Professional Pipeline
High-end creators don’t use AI for video in a vacuum. It is part of a “hybrid workflow” that combines traditional software with neural generation.
The VFX Sandwich
A common professional technique is the “VFX Sandwich.” A creator films a real actor on a simple set (the base), uses AI for video to generate a complex, hyper-realistic background (the middle), and then uses traditional compositing software like DaVinci Resolve or After Effects to glue them together (the top). This ensures the human performance is real while the environment is limited only by imagination.
Storyboarding and Pre-Visualization
Before a single camera is rented, directors use AI for video for “Pre-Viz.” They generate “moving storyboards” to show clients exactly how a 30-second commercial will look.
